Configure with the Command Line Interface (CLI)Caution If another device on your network already uses the router’s default IP
address, 192.168.1.1, do not connect the AR750S-DP to the network until you
have changed the IP address of the router’s default VLAN using the CLI.
1. Initiate router start-up.
Using the terminal cable supplied, connect a VT100-compatible terminal, or
the COM port of a PC running a terminal emulation program such as
Windows Hyper Terminal, to the Console RS-232 (ASYN0) port on the
router’s front panel.
Set the communication parameters on your terminal or terminal emulation
program to:
• Baud rate: 9600
• Data bits: 8
• Parity: None
• Stop bits: 1
• Flow control: Hardware
See the AR700 Series Router Hardware Reference for more information on
configuring emulation software.
